KNowing the tone and Style expectations in the GIG description, Brainstorm a concept you'd bring to life if you're accepted into this GIG.
If I get selected, I’d like to create a short content series based on “Student Life Made Easier with PDFs.” The idea is to show real-life situations that students face daily, like last-minute assignments, messy notes, or group projects, and how tools like Adobe Acrobat can actually make things simpler. For example, I could create short reels or posts showing how to quickly combine notes, add comments for group work, or convert files without stress. I’d keep the tone relatable and slightly fun, so it feels like something students would actually watch and share. I’d also try to involve other students by asking them how they manage their work and turning that into content, so it feels more real and community-driven rather than just informational.
